Agradwip railway station is a railway station on Bandel–Katwa line connecting from to Katwa, and under the jurisdiction of Howrah railway division of Eastern Railway zone. It is situated beside State Highway 6 at Gazipur, Agradwip of Purba Bardhaman district in the Indian state of West Bengal.[1] Few EMUs and passengers trains stop at Agradwip railway station.[2]
The Hooghly–Katwa Railway constructed a line from Bandel to Katwa in 1913.[3] This line including Agradwip railway station was electrified in 1994–96 with 25 kV overhead line.Nearby Village name Choto Meigachi.[4]
